U.S. Predator Drone Fired on Qaddafi Convoy, Official Says


The official said the drone and French jet fired on a "large convoy" leaving Qaddafi's hometown of Sirte. A French defense official earlier said about 80 vehicles were in the convoy -- the official said the strike did not destroy the convoy but that fighters on the ground afterward intercepted the vehicle carrying Qaddafi.

270 people killed by the Libyan explosion of Pan Am Flight 103, which also destroyed 21 homes in Lockerbie Scotland weren't very joyful either in the aftermath of the December 21, 1988, disaster ordered by Gadhafi as he admitted in 2003. Bombing of Pan Am Flight 103.

From link:
Wreckage was strewn over 50 square miles. Twenty-one of Lockerbie's houses were completely destroyed and eleven of its residents were dead. Thus, the total death toll was 270 (the 259 aboard the plane plus the 11 on the ground).
